Frameworks and APIs

jQuery

http://jquery.com/ JavaScript API that provides a simpler syntax than plain JavaScript for reading and manipulating HTML elements.

Knockout

http://knockoutjs.com/ JavaScript framework that manages model-view separation using the MVVM architectural pattern. Such a framewortk is required by pages that do not reload HTML with hardcoded values but instead update values in the current page.

Flight

http://flightphp.com/ Very small PHP framework that manages some of the tasks common for web projects, such as routing, caching and composite views. Flight also to some extent helps give the application a MVC structure.

Web Development Browser Plugins

  • Firebug, http://www.getfirebug.com/ Firebug enables inspecting, modifying and debugging HTML, CSS, JavaScript, network activity and more.
  • Web Developer, http://chrispederick.com/work/web-developer/ Web developer can display and change lots of properties of a displayed web page, for example cookies, forms, images and window size. It can also validate HTML and CSS.
  • Inspect Element Many browsers has a inspect element option when right-clicking on a web page, which provides a useful interface to the chosen element of the current page.
